Tile damage repair services involve the restoration and replacement of broken, cracked, or missing tiles in various settings. Skilled contractors assess the extent of the damage, remove the compromised tiles, and replace them with matching materials to restore the surface’s appearance and functionality. The process may also include addressing underlying issues such as subfloor damage or grout deterioration to ensure a durable and long-lasting repair. Proper repair helps maintain the aesthetic appeal of tiled surfaces while preventing further deterioration caused by water infiltration or structural weaknesses.

This service addresses common problems such as cracked tiles, loose tiles, chipped surfaces, and grout failure. Over time, tiles can become damaged due to impacts, shifting foundations, or wear and tear, leading to unsightly patches or compromised surfaces. Repairing damaged tiles can prevent issues like water leaks, mold growth, and structural damage that might result from exposed or weakened areas. Restoring damaged tiles also helps preserve the value of the property by maintaining a clean and well-kept appearance in both residential and commercial spaces.

The overview below groups typical Tile Damage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lincoln County, NC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Tile Damage Repair Costs - The cost to repair damaged tiles typically ranges from $200 to $800, depending on the extent of the damage and tile type. Small cracks or chips may cost around $50 to $150 per tile, while larger repairs can be more expensive.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ific damage assessments.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for tile damage repair usually fall between $40 and $80 per hour, with total costs varying based on repair complexity. Simple fixes may take a few hours, totaling approximately $100 to $300, while extensive repairs can increase costs significantly. Contact local contractors for detailed estimates.

Material Costs - The price of replacement tiles can range from $2 to $15 per square foot, depending on the material and style. Additional supplies like grout or adhesive may add $20 to $50 to the overall expense. Local service providers can assist in sourcing the appropriate materials.

Additional Charges - Extra costs may include surface preparation or removal of damaged tiles, which can add $50 to $200 to the total. Complex repairs or those involving underlying issues might incur higher charges. Local pros can evaluate the specific repair needs for accurate pricing.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
